September 22, 2024CNN's KFILE found that Mark Robinson, the Republican nominee for governor of North Carolina, made a series of inflammatory comments on a pornography website's message board. Robinson referred to himself as a "black NAZI!" and expressed support for reinstating slavery. Robinson denies making the remarks and they predate his entry into politics. Before the comments were unearthed, former President Donald Trump praised Robinson and called him "Martin Luther King on steroids."
